This is a list of the most crowded cities in the United States. These cities are special because they have the most people living inside their borders. When we talk about a city's population, we mean only the people who live inside the city's official lines. This is different from counting all the people who live around a city in smaller towns or villages.

Cities can change over time. Some grow very big, while others stay about the same size. Knowing which cities have the most people helps us understand where many Americans live and work. It also shows how some places become more popular than others.

The list includes only people who live inside a city's borders. It does not count people who live in the surrounding areas, even if they visit or work in the city every day. This way, each city can be compared fairly, based only on its own population.

50 states and the District of Columbia

This table shows the 346 incorporated places in the United States with at least 100,000 people as of July 1, 2024. These places include cities, towns, and other types of communities. Five states do not have any cities this big: Delaware, Maine, Vermont, West Virginia, and Wyoming.

The table gives information such as the city's rank, name, state, population in 2024 and 2020, how much the population changed, the land area, how many people live in each square mile, and the city's location coordinates.

The total population of all these big cities in 2020 was about 96.6 million people, which is roughly 29% of the whole U.S. population. Together, they cover about 29,588 square miles (76,630 km2). On average, each of these cities had about 301,765 people and 4,151 people living in every square mile (1,603/km2).

Puerto Rico

The following table shows the five largest municipalities in Puerto Rico with more than 100,000 people as of July 1, 2024, based on estimates from the United States Census Bureau. If these cities were part of the overall list for the United States, San Juan would be the 58th largest city in the country.

The table includes details such as the city's rank, population numbers from 2024 and 2020, population changes, land area, population density, and geographic coordinates.

Other U.S. territories

The United States has several territories, including American Samoa, Guam, the Northern Mariana Islands, and the U.S. Virgin Islands. In these areas, there are no cities that have populations of 100,000 people or more. These territories are special parts of the United States, but they are not states.

Census-designated places

A census-designated place (CDP) is an area where many people live, but it does not have its own city government. The United States Census Bureau uses these areas for counting people during the census, similar to cities and towns.

The following table shows the largest CDPs in the United States with at least 100,000 people, based on the 2020 census. It includes details like the population in 2020 and 2010, how much the population changed, the land area, how many people live in each area, and the location coordinates.

Cities formerly over 100,000 people

See also: Rust Belt and Urban decay

This table shows cities in the United States that used to have more than 100,000 people living in them. However, their populations have since gone down below this number, or they have joined with or been taken in by a nearby city.
